宝信软件(国企)技术面-软件工程师
没有大厂一样的去手撕代码和问八股,主要考察项目内容和场景题
1.数据库写入失败的过程
2.软件设计原则
3.设计模式分类和优劣
4.生产者消费者模式的具体应用中间件技术(项目中用到了)
5.C++自带的文件监听库函数(项目中用了 windows api)
6.继承的实现技术(基类子类、组合继承?这个组合继承是面试官给的例子自己没了解过)
7.智能指针实现原理
8.移动拷贝构造实现原理
9.怎么平衡生产者和消费者的关系(项目中提过但是具体内容自己没有实现,被问住了)
!!!总结:基本问题都是从项目出发以上问题只是由项目本身衍生出来的,考的很灵活,而且抓住一个点一直问,比如设计模式这块,因为项目中用到了生产者和消费者,面试官很感兴趣,所以很多问题都围绕这个去问,设计模式只是思想,最好不要死记硬背,要有自己的想法和改进点#秋招##国企##宝信软件##设计模式#
1.数据库写入失败的过程
2.软件设计原则
3.设计模式分类和优劣
4.生产者消费者模式的具体应用中间件技术(项目中用到了)
5.C++自带的文件监听库函数(项目中用了 windows api)
6.继承的实现技术(基类子类、组合继承?这个组合继承是面试官给的例子自己没了解过)
7.智能指针实现原理
8.移动拷贝构造实现原理
9.怎么平衡生产者和消费者的关系(项目中提过但是具体内容自己没有实现,被问住了)
!!!总结:基本问题都是从项目出发以上问题只是由项目本身衍生出来的,考的很灵活,而且抓住一个点一直问,比如设计模式这块,因为项目中用到了生产者和消费者,面试官很感兴趣,所以很多问题都围绕这个去问,设计模式只是思想,最好不要死记硬背,要有自己的想法和改进点#秋招##国企##宝信软件##设计模式#